Pas (physician associates/physician assistants) are licensed clinicians who practice medicine in every specialty and setting. They may practice in a primary care setting or a specialty setting, teaming up with a physician or a surgeon. A physician’s assistant (pa) is a licensed clinician who practices medicine in partnership with doctors. Physician assistants are highly educated clinicians who can perform diagnoses and prescribe medications under the supervision of a licensed. Physician assistants graduate as medical generalists. A physician assistant (pa) is a health care professional who works with doctors and gives medical treatment. Today, pas play an essential role in areas with limited medical access. Pas are trained in a medical model that emphasizes disease diagnosis and treatment.
